Whether you have a large or multi-generational family or you are looking to develop a hospitality business this impressive Victorian residence, only a five minute stroll from Totland beach, should tick all the boxes. It has an inordinate amount of flexible accommodation but is currently configured to include eight bedrooms, a two bedroom annex and a two bedroom self-contained cottage. The property is accessed via a driveway where you can park at least seven cars flanked by lawns, shrubs and hedging and, with its black and white elevation, varied roof lines, a canopied bay window and pitched roof dormer echoing the pitched roof porch, it has great kerb appeal. Internally the property also retains some delightful features from a bygone era particularly in the hall including a period front door with leaded light inserts, an arched skylight and side windows as well as solid wood flooring, half height panelled walls, the original staircase and coved ceilings. At the same time it has been sympathetically updated to provide everything needed for modern day living. There is a very large dual aspect sitting/dining room with a wide archway and a charming bay window as well as a box bay window providing plenty of natural light. A good sized lounge offers a relaxing space where you can enjoy a good read while the kitchen/breakfast room includes contemporary grey units housing a double oven, hob and dishwasher with additional stand-alone appliances. Also on the ground floor in the main house is a cloakroom, study and a double bedroom with an en suite bathroom and a door to the rear lobby. On the first floor there are four double bedrooms including three with en suite showers and one with an en suite bathroom. This floor also includes the utility room and laundry facilities as well as access to the lower floor of the annex with its kitchen, bathroom and lounge/dining room and a staircase to the two annex double bedrooms on the second floor. In the main part of the house on the second floor there are three further double bedrooms providing glimpses of the sea and a family bathroom. This area could become a couple of bedrooms and a sitting room for teenagers or adult family members wanting a private space.What the Owner says:
We moved here about 15 years ago because we had a growing and extended family and we knew the previous owners who had painstakingly renovated the property from top to bottom. During our time here we also ran a small bed and breakfast business for a few years which worked very well in addition to looking after a large family but they have now flown the nest so we feel it is time to downsize. There is lapsed planning for demolition of the existing summer house into construction of a chalet for holiday letting. It is very quiet and peaceful and Totland is becoming a very sought after area. It includes the delightful Waterfront bar and restaurant that we can walk to and it is not far to The Hut at Colwell Bay, which is one of the most popular restaurants on the island. We can be on the beach in five minutes or enjoy a delightful stroll to Headon Warren, Afton and Tennyson Downs. We are only about a mile from Freshwater with its pubs, restaurants and cafes, while golfers can enjoy their game at the Freshwater Bay Golf Club. The Freshwater Sports Club and West Bay Country Club and Spa are not far away for other leisure facilities. We are less than three miles from Yarmouth that, as well as the ferry port and marina, includes a 16th century castle, a Grade II listed pier that provides views across The Solent and a raft of restaurants, bars and individual shops.
